What is Art Index Retrospective?

The Art Index Retrospective is an archival index that spans more than fifty years of art writing. It indexes thousands of book reviews, interviews, anthologies, and other materials on fine, decorative, and commercial art in addition to hundreds of publications.

Art Index Retrospective, volumes 1–32, spans the years 1929–1984. More than 420 international journals are cited in the database's entries. Yearbooks and museum bulletins are also included in the coverage. Periodicals published in English, French, Italian, German, Spanish, and Dutch are also covered. Art Index identifies reproductions of works of art that are published in indexed magazines in addition to articles. Art Full Text launches in 1984 and continues Art Index's coverage.

Free blacks in the antebellum period—those years from the formation of the Union until the Civil War—were quite outspoken about the injustice of slavery. Their ability to express themselves, however, was determined by whether they lived in the North or the South. Free Southern blacks continued to live under the shadow of slavery, unable to travel or assemble as freely as those in the North. It was also more difficult for them to organize and sustain churches, schools, or fraternal orders such as the Masons. Although their lives were circumscribed by numerous discriminatory laws even in the colonial period, freed African Americans, especially in the North, were active participants in American society. Black men enlisted as soldiers and fought in the American Revolution and the War of 1812. Some owned land, homes, businesses, and paid taxes. In some Northern cities, for brief periods of time, black property owners voted. A very small number of free blacks owned slaves. The slaves that most free blacks purchased were relatives whom they later manumitted. A few free blacks also owned slave holding plantations in Louisiana, Virginia, and South Carolina. Free African American Christians founded their own churches which became the hub of the economic, social, and intellectual lives of blacks in many areas of the fledgling nation. Blacks were also outspoken in print. Freedom's Journal, the first black-owned newspaper, appeared in 1827. This paper and other early writings by blacks fueled the attack against slavery and racist conceptions about the intellectual inferiority of African Americans. African Americans also engaged in achieving freedom for others, which was a complex and dangerous undertaking. Enslaved blacks and their white sympathizers planned secret flight strategies and escape routes for runaways to make their way to freedom. Although it was neither subterranean nor a mechanized means of travel, this network of routes and hiding places was known as the “underground railroad.” Some free blacks were active “conductors” on the underground railroad while others simply harbored runaways in their homes. Free people of color like Richard Allen, Frederick Douglass, Sojourner Truth, David Walker, and Prince Hall earned national reputations for themselves by writing, speaking, organizing, and agitating on behalf of their enslaved compatriots. Thousands of freed blacks, with the aid of interested whites, returned to Africa with the aid of the American Colonization Society and colonized what eventually became Liberia. While some African Americans chose this option, the vast majority felt themselves to be Americans and focused their efforts on achieving equality within the United States.

The land ordinance of  1785 determined how many western lands would be stablishing a plan for surveying western lands.

On May 20, 1785, the United States Congress of the Confederation approved the Land Ordinance of 1785.It established a uniform method by which settlers could acquire title to farmland in the undeveloped west.Land sales were an important source of revenue because Congress at the time lacked the authority to increase revenue through direct taxation.The earlier Land Ordinance of 1784 was a resolution written by Thomas Jefferson urging Congress to take action. The survey system established by the Ordinance eventually covered more than three-quarters of the continental United States

Ten separate states were to be created from the land west of the Appalachian Mountains, north of the Ohio River, and east of the Mississippi River. However, the 1784 resolution did not specify how the territories would be governed or settled before they became states.The Northwest Ordinance of 1787 addressed political requirements, while the Ordinance of 1785 brought the resolution of 1784 into effect by providing a means of selling and settling the land

Travel between sub-Saharan Africa and North Africa through the Sahara is necessary for trans-Saharan trade. Although trade has existed from the beginning of time, its apex occurred between the eighth and early seventeenth centuries.

The environment in the Sahara used to be considerably different. Since at least 7000 BC, major towns, pastoralism, the herding of sheep and goats, and pottery have all been practised in Libya and Algeria. Between 4000 and 3500 BC, cattle were first brought to the Central Sahara (Ahaggar).

In locations that are today exceedingly dry, remarkable rock drawings from 3500 to 2500 BC depict flora and fauna that are not existent in the contemporary desert environment. The Sahara is now a hostile desert that divides the economies of the Niger valley and the Mediterranean.

What do you mean by Grange and farmer's alliance?

The Grange, originally known as the Patrons of Husbandry, was established in 1867 to support farm life and their families and assist farmers with the purchase of equipment, the construction of grain elevators, pushing for government regulation of railroad shipping costs, and other farm-related tasks. There were more than a million members by the early 1870s.

The Patrons of Husbandry gave rise to the Farmers' Alliances. Farmers' Alliances were significantly more politically engaged than the Grange, which was more of a social group.
